Crynodeb
The Grange is a 26 bed nursing home situated in the village of Sherborne St John near Basingstoke. We are currently seeking a Kitchen Assistant to join our existing catering team. 30 hours per week to include alternate weekends.
Duties (this is not an exhaustive list)
Assist in the preparation of ingredients for meals, including washing, chopping, and measuring.
preparation and serving of light snacks, sandwiches etc.
Maintain cleanliness of the kitchen and equipment, according to the cleaning schedules and as directed by the Cooks.
Ensure the dining area is kept clean and tidy, tables laid in preparation for meals.
Qualifications
Previous experience in a restaurant or kitchen environment in a care setting is preferred but not essential.
Basic knowledge of food safety practices and culinary techniques.
Ability to work effectively in a team-oriented atmosphere.
Strong attention to detail and organisational skills.
Willingness to learn and adapt in a fast-paced environment.
Good communication skills and a positive attitude towards teamwork.
Flexibility to cover shifts as required.
